Abstract
Nickel(II)complexes with the bicyclic tetraamine L=[2 sup4.3
sup1]adamanzane, ,4,7,10- tetraaza- bicyclo[5.5.3]pentadecane)
have been synthesized. The reaction of NiBr sub 2 with [2 sup4.3
sup1]adz in dimethylformamide gives a dibromo-bridged dinuclear
complex [{Ni(L)}sub2(mu-Br)sub2]Br sub2. From this crude product
pure {Ni(L)}sub2 (mu-Br)sub2](ClO sub4)sub2 and {Ni(L)}sub 2
(mu-Cl)sub 2](ClO sub4)sub2 have been obtained. In aqueous
solution these dinuclear species hydrolyse to the parent
mononuclear diaqua species, which was isolated as [Ni(L)(H
sub2O)sub2]S sub2O sub6 x 2H sub2O. The reaction of the diaqua
complex with nitrite gives [Ni(L)(NO sub2)]ClO sub4 or [Ni(L)(NO
sub2)]PF sub6 and with nitrate [Ni(L)(NO sub3)]ClO sub4 is
obtained. Equilibrium studies of the formation of the nitrito and
nitrato complexes are reported. The structures of
[{Ni(L)}sub2(mu-Cl) sub2](ClO sub4)sub2, [Ni(L)(H sub2O)sub2]S
sub2O sub6 x 2H sub2O, [Ni(L)(NO sub2)]PF sub6 and Ni(L) (NO
sub3)]ClO sub4 have been determined by X-ray diffraction
techniques. The coordination geometry about the nickel(II) ion is
a distorted octahedron in all the structures.
